I had one, and it died on me in about a year. Before that I had a 2012 naga for about 12 years and it ran well for about 6 years before I needed to start working on it. Pulling hair out of the scroll wheel's inside, and adding super glue to the lmb part that pushes the switch since it would wear out. For the naga pro v2, I've found that it works pretty well, but the side buttons sometimes need to be resealed because they occasionally stop working.

Deoxit f5 fixed my 2012 Naga’s double click. Disassembled it and sprayed the switches. Works perfectly still.
